diff --git a/src/plugins/designer/qtcreatorintegration.cpp b/src/plugins/designer/qtcreatorintegration.cpp index 421854a3644..f756c8c1969 100644 --- a/src/plugins/designer/qtcreatorintegration.cpp +++ b/src/plugins/designer/qtcreatorintegration.cpp @@ -68,6 +68,7 @@ #include #include +#include #include #include @@ -81,11 +82,13 @@ static QString msgClassNotFound(const QString &uiClassName, const QListfileName(); + files += QLatin1Char('\n'); + files += QDir::toNativeSeparators(doc->fileName()); } - return QtCreatorIntegration::tr("The class definition of '%1' could not be found in %2.").arg(uiClassName, files); + return QtCreatorIntegration::tr( + "The class containing '%1' could not be found in %2.\n" + "Please verify the #include-directives.") + .arg(uiClassName, files); } QtCreatorIntegration::QtCreatorIntegration(QDesignerFormEditorInterface *core, FormEditorW *parent) :